I've done it. BUT it's tricky and takes lots of modifications.

First thing to remember is 1 SP is $10,000 C-Bills.
10 SP is 1 WP.

Basically you play the tracks in book as you want. But you need to convert back and forth between C-Bills,SP, and WP and use the GM mode and add an subtract funds from MekHQ.

With the currency conversions in place use MekHQ to repair, buy supplies, etc.

Use the non-AtB scenario abilities in MekHQ to build the scenarios (see the included scenarios as an example). Launch Megamek from MekHQ in the scenario. 

Once in Megamek use the RATs or Force Builder tools to make an Opfor. Play and resolve back into MekHQ.

It's more work to juggle the tracks outside of MekHQ but very doable.  I did find that some of the rewards converted to C-Bills where low but just tweak them to be fair.

When (no ETA) we get Story Arcs this will be the first book I convert for them.
